Join Door4 as we explore digital performance measurement and analytics. Find out how growth brands identify and track "the metrics that matter".

Are you finding GA4 and web analytics overwhelming?
Struggling to measure the true impact of your SEO, advertising, and web strategies?

Join us for “The Metrics That Matter,” an interactive workshop designed to help you master data-driven decision-making and drive growth for Home & Garden brands.

Whenever we ask clients and partners what they want to learn more about, analytics and measuring effectiveness always top the list. That’s why we’ve created this session—so you can gain the knowledge you need to succeed.

Interactive session led by Door4 experts

“The Metrics That Matter” will help you overcome analysis paralysis and make data-driven decisions with confidence. By simplifying the overwhelming data landscape, you’ll be able to clearly understand cause-and-effect relationships and optimise your strategies.

Here’s a glimpse of what you’ll learn:

  • How to master GA4 and gain deep insights into user behaviour.
  • What to track—and what not to track—to get the most out of your data.
  • The pros and cons of attribution modelling.
  • Hidden insights most analytics packages don’t reveal.
  • How to confidently interpret data to optimize your marketing efforts.

Understand the key metrics that drive SEO, advertising, and web conversions.

Many businesses face conflicting data from multiple platforms like Google, Meta, and Adobe. How do you plan effectively when your resources are confusing at best?

We’ll walk you through creating a ‘Measurement Plan’ that gets everyone in your team on the same page. You’ll learn how to translate this into actionable insights that make a real impact across your marketing channels.
